编程游戏有什么主题吗知乎

fiy 其他 10

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程游戏主题多种多样,根据不同的目的和玩家群体,可以有以下几种主题:

    1. 编程教育主题:这类游戏旨在通过游戏的形式教授编程知识和技能,帮助玩家学习和理解编程语言、算法、数据结构等基础知识。例如,编程之道、编程猫等游戏都属于这一主题,它们提供了逐步引导、互动式学习的环境,让初学者能够轻松入门编程。

    2. 逻辑思维主题:这类游戏注重培养玩家的逻辑思维能力和解决问题的能力。通过设计各种谜题和难题,让玩家运用编程技巧和逻辑思维来解决。例如,人工迷宫、光追之旅等游戏都是以解谜为核心,玩家需要通过编程来解决各种难题。

    3. 创意开发主题:这类游戏鼓励玩家发挥创造力,通过编程创作出各种独特的作品。例如,Minecraft、Roblox等游戏提供了强大的创作工具和编程接口,玩家可以自由设计、建造各种游戏场景、物品和机制,实现自己的创意。

    4. 竞技对战主题:这类游戏注重玩家之间的对战和竞争,通过编程来控制角色或战斗单位进行战斗。例如,编程对战游戏Lightbot、CodeCombat等,玩家需要编写出最优的代码来指挥自己的角色战胜对手。

    5. 虚拟现实主题:这类游戏结合了编程和虚拟现实技术,让玩家能够身临其境地体验编程的乐趣。例如,VR编程游戏《Tilt Brush》、《Job Simulator》等,玩家可以通过手势、语音等方式来编写代码和操作虚拟环境。

    总而言之,编程游戏主题多样化,既可以作为教育工具,也可以作为娱乐方式,无论是初学者还是有经验的程序员,都能够从中获得乐趣和收获。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程游戏有很多不同的主题,每个主题都有自己独特的特点和玩法。以下是一些常见的编程游戏主题:

    1. 迷宫解谜:这类游戏通常要求玩家使用编程语言来解决迷宫中的谜题。玩家需要编写代码来控制角色移动、收集物品、避开障碍物等,最终找到迷宫的出口。

    2. 逻辑推理:这类游戏注重逻辑思维和推理能力的培养。玩家需要使用编程语言来解决一系列的逻辑问题,如推理谜题、逻辑门电路等。通过编写代码,玩家能够锻炼逻辑思维和问题解决能力。

    3. 建造模拟:这类游戏让玩家扮演建筑师或工程师的角色,使用编程语言来设计和构建各种建筑物、机器人或其他物品。玩家可以通过编写代码来控制建筑物的运行、机器人的动作等,从而实现自己的创意和想法。

    4. 数据可视化:这类游戏旨在教授玩家数据处理和可视化的基础知识。玩家需要使用编程语言来处理和分析数据,并将结果以图表、图形等形式呈现出来。通过编写代码,玩家可以学习数据处理的方法和技巧,同时也能够提高对数据的理解能力。

    5. 虚拟现实:这类游戏结合了编程和虚拟现实技术,让玩家在虚拟世界中进行编程体验。玩家可以通过编写代码来控制虚拟角色的动作、与虚拟环境进行交互等。这种游戏方式可以提供更加沉浸式的编程学习体验,让玩家更好地理解编程原理和概念。

    这些只是编程游戏中的一些常见主题,实际上还有很多其他类型的编程游戏,如算法挑战、模拟经营等。每个主题都有不同的教育目标和游戏机制,玩家可以根据自己的兴趣和学习需求选择适合自己的编程游戏。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程游戏是一种通过游戏化的方式来学习和实践编程技能的工具。它们可以有不同的主题,旨在吸引不同年龄和技能水平的玩家。以下是一些常见的编程游戏主题。

    1. 解谜游戏:这类游戏通过解决编程难题来推动游戏进程。玩家需要运用逻辑思维和编程知识来找出问题的解决方案。这类游戏常常包含迷宫、密码破解、逻辑门等元素,旨在锻炼玩家的问题解决能力和创造力。

    2. 模拟游戏:这类游戏模拟了现实生活中的编程环境,例如创建和管理自己的虚拟公司、编写代码来开发软件或游戏等。玩家可以在游戏中体验到真实编程工作的方方面面,包括项目管理、团队合作、代码调试等。

    3. 平台游戏:这类游戏将编程技能与传统的平台游戏元素相结合,玩家需要使用编程语言来控制游戏角色完成关卡。这种游戏能够激发玩家的创造力和想象力,使他们能够设计和构建自己的游戏世界。

    4. 创造型游戏:这类游戏提供了一个开放的环境,让玩家可以自由地设计和实现自己的创意。玩家可以使用编程语言来创建自己的游戏角色、场景和游戏规则。这种游戏鼓励玩家发挥创造力,培养编程思维和创新能力。

    5. 教育游戏:这类游戏旨在教授编程基础知识和概念。它们通常以简单易懂的方式呈现编程概念,通过互动的方式引导玩家学习。这些游戏可以帮助初学者掌握编程语言的基本语法和编程逻辑。

    总之,编程游戏的主题多种多样,每个主题都有不同的教学目标和玩法。选择适合自己的主题可以更好地提高编程技能和兴趣。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部